proportional relationships do you think that the number of heartbeats you can count is proportional to the number of seconds tha

t you check your pulse ?/
Mathematics
1 answer:
MatroZZZ [7]3 years ago
8 0
The answer will be yes.

The heart beats at a fixed rate. The average heartbeat is about 72 per minute which is about 6 heartbeats in ever 5 seconds.

If we will count the number of heartbeats for more seconds, the number of beats will increase in proportion to the above rate. So increasing the number of seconds is increasing the number of heartbeats, thus, we can conclude that there is a direction proportion between the two quantities.
